Output 5958e21b1e4280c76a950f98c1fbb857b1f482b6d2c269d55ff6c591d37bdbc9: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86832829b90b167fae57ab864d34d393ba4896a1 OP_EQUAL
address
3DxFbBvyMVSDEMrnUKeyzjdXt7UkdmNyRu
transaction
5958e21b1e4280c76a950f98c1fbb857b1f482b6d2c269d55ff6c591d37bdbc9
spent
true